Power Rankings: Hamlin accomplishing, just not winning

In 36 races since he last took a checkered flag, Denny Hamlin has 13 top fives, nine finishes of third or second -- and no victories, In his latest Power Rankings, Brian De Los Santos says Hamlin takes this approach: Strong runs now might lead to a Chase breakthrough later.

Harvick takes rain-delayed trucks win at Martinsville

Kevin Harvick passed Kyle Busch with just over nine laps to go and held on through a final restart to win the rain-delayed trucks race Monday before a very sparse crowd at Martinsville Speedway.

Johnson testifies at Castroneves’ tax-evasion trial

NASCAR champion Jimmie Johnson was the leadoff defense witness Monday in the Helio Castroneves tax-evasion trial, testifying that a lawyer who is also charged in the case has a sterling reputation in the motorsports world.

Button nips Barrichello in F1’s opening Australian GP

Jenson Button won the season-opening Australian Grand Prix on Sunday, beating teammate Rubens Barrichello and giving Brawn GP a 1-2 finish in its first race.
